光拍法测光速的实验误差分析及方法改进 被引量:3

The Errors Analysis and Improvement of Light Velocity Measuring with Light-beat Method
下载PDF
导出
摘要 传统的光拍法测光速的实验误差在0.5%到8%之间。本文通过分析产生实验误差的主要原因,总结相关文献提到的改进方法的优缺点,使用CG-IV型光速测定仪,通过改用具有光标功能的YB4325型示波器、使用Excel软件对实验数据进行处理等手段对实验进行改进。通过优化测量方法、多次实测后发现,改良后的实验得到的光速值误差均在1%以下,实验精度得到明显提高,改良效果十分理想。 The result of traditional light-beat method experiment is imprecise with relative errors ranging from0. 5% to 8%. Starting with the introduction of the experimental principle,detailed analysis of experimental procedure and data processing as well as summaries of other improved experiment are presented in this paper. After a series of experiments,we find that errors are mostly introduced when measuring remote light path and observing phase on the oscilloscope. We use the CG-IV light meter to improve the experiment by optimizing measurement,using YB-4325 oscilloscope with cursor function and processing data with Excel. Experiment results that relative errors are totally lower than 1% showing than the measuring precision is effectively promoted. In addition,tips for experimenters are given in detail to further ensure the smooth and accuracy of the experiment.
